Subject: net: ipv4: current group_info should be put after using.

[ Upstream commit b04c46190219a4f845e46a459e3102137b7f6cac ]

Plug a group_info refcount leak in ping_init.
group_info is only needed during initialization and
the code failed to release the reference on exit.
While here move grabbing the reference to a place
where it is actually needed.

 net/ipv4/ping.c | 15 +++++++++++----
 1 file changed, 11 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-)

diff --git a/net/ipv4/ping.c b/net/ipv4/ping.c
index 242e7f4..3ef2919 100644
--- a/net/ipv4/ping.c
+++ b/net/ipv4/ping.c
@@ -248,26 +248,33 @@ int ping_init_sock(struct sock *sk)
 {
 	struct net *net = sock_net(sk);
 	kgid_t group = current_egid();
-	struct group_info *group_info = get_current_groups();
-	int i, j, count = group_info->ngroups;
+	struct group_info *group_info;
+	int i, j, count;
 	kgid_t low, high;
+	int ret = 0;

 	inet_get_ping_group_range_net(net, &low, &high);
 	if (gid_lte(low, group) && gid_lte(group, high))
 		return 0;

+	group_info = get_current_groups();
+	count = group_info->ngroups;
 	for (i = 0; i < group_info->nblocks; i++) {
 		int cp_count = min_t(int, NGROUPS_PER_BLOCK, count);
 		for (j = 0; j < cp_count; j++) {
 			kgid_t gid = group_info->blocks[i][j];
 			if (gid_lte(low, gid) && gid_lte(gid, high))
-				return 0;
+				goto out_release_group;
 		}

 		count -= cp_count;
 	}

-	return -EACCES;
+	ret = -EACCES;
+
+out_release_group:
+	put_group_info(group_info);
+	return ret;
 }
 E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(ping_init_sock);
